ATI Radeon X800 GT AGP videocard review

ATI Radeon X800 GT AGP

Radeon X800 GT AGP videocard released by ATI; release date: 8 November 2007. The videocard is designed for desktop-computers and based on R400 microarchitecture codenamed R420.

Core clock speed - 473 MHz. Texture fill rate - 5.7 GTexel / s. Manufacturing process technology - 130 nm. Transistors count - 160 million. Power consumption (TDP) - 40 Watt.

Memory type: GDDR3. Maximum RAM amount - 256 MB. Memory bus width - 256 Bit. Memory clock speed - 986 MHz. Memory bandwidth - 31.55 GB / s.
